Lynnwood power out for a couple hours - some remain in the dark.. Power went out to many Brier and Lynnwood homes yesterday around 3:40 when according to the Snohomish PUD, a semi hit an electrical pole.  After two hours of being in the dark in Brier, I called and was told that they would have the power back on within the hour for all those except the twenty or so homes that are directly surrounding the pole.  These lucky winners get to have their power out for about 48 hours because it takes a while to replace a pole apparently.  The pole in question was neer Larch and 215th and driving around was not easy with all the lights down as well. My most recent sale in Lynnwood WA was a cute house with lots of wonderful upgrades.  It had been remodeled extensively, but we still had a few things come up during inspection.   There are a lot of things that the buyers may not have necessarily asked for from the seller, but I wanted to on their behalf and luckily they were open to my ideas. 1. Smoke Detectors were not working.  The seller had already certified on the Snohomish county only NWMLS addendum 22Z that the smoke detectors were operational so it was a no brainer to just ask them to do what they had already promised to do.  It wouldn't have cost them very much and again it wasn't asking them to do anything more than what they were legally required to do in Snohomish County anyway.  The key issue for me was the safety of my cl...

A professionally staged home gives buyers the opportunity to picture themselves living comfortably in each room.  When rooms are empty, buyers often have a difficult time figuring out where their furniture would go or even if it would fit into the space.   This is especially true in bedrooms that appear to be small when they are unfurnished.  You need to show the buyer that, yes, a queen sized bed will fit comfortably in this master bedroom:     "Extra" bedrooms are often tiny, and appear smaller when empty.  Here a small room is staged as a 's bedroom with twin bed, night table and dresser.  Plenty of space for the essentials of a child's room.   In this extra bedroom, we used a double bed to stage a boy's bedroom.  By using a double bed instead of a twin, we are showing buyers that is...
